Wave Properties
This lesson will cover the properties and behavior of waves, including different types of waves such as mechanical and electromagnetic waves. We will discuss the properties of waves including wavelength, frequency, amplitude and speed. We will also examine the behavior of sound waves and how they propagate through different mediums. In addition, we will discuss the principle of superposition, which explains how waves interact with each other, and standing waves, which are a type of wave that appears to be standing still.
